removed double include
[libfirm] / ir / debug / dbginfo_t.h
index c7894d2..33e24e6 100644 (file)
 /**
  * The current merge_pair_func(), access only from inside firm.
  */
-extern void (*__dbg_info_merge_pair)(ir_node *nw, ir_node *old,
-                                    dbg_action info);
+extern merge_pair_func *__dbg_info_merge_pair;
 
 /**
  * The current merge_sets_func(), access only from inside firm.
  */
-extern void (*__dbg_info_merge_sets)(ir_node **new_nodes, int n_new_nodes,
-                                    ir_node **old_nodes, int n_old_nodes,
-                                    dbg_action info);
+extern merge_sets_func *__dbg_info_merge_sets;
+
+/**
+ * The current snprint_dbg_func(), access only from inside firm.
+ */
+extern snprint_dbg_func *__dbg_info_snprint;
 
 #endif /* __DBGINFO_T_H__ */